[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index] [Xen-devel] [PATCH v8 03/13] x86/hvm: add length to mmio check op
When memory mapped I/O is range checked by internal handlers, the length
of the access should be taken into account.

diff --git a/xen/arch/x86/hvm/intercept.c b/xen/arch/x86/hvm/intercept.c
index f97ee52..f4dbf17 100644
--- a/xen/arch/x86/hvm/intercept.c
+++ b/xen/arch/x86/hvm/intercept.c
@@ -35,9 +35,20 @@
static bool_t hvm_mmio_accept(const struct hvm_io_handler *handler,
const ioreq_t *p)
{
+ paddr_t first = hvm_mmio_first_byte(p);
+ paddr_t last = hvm_mmio_last_byte(p);
+
BUG_ON(handler->type != IOREQ_TYPE_COPY);
- return handler->mmio.ops->check(current, p->addr);
+ if ( !handler->mmio.ops->check(current, first) )
+ return 0;
+
+ /* Make sure the handler will accept the whole access */
+ if ( p->size > 1 &&
+ !handler->mmio.ops->check(current, last) )
+ domain_crash(current->domain);
+
+ return 1;
}

diff --git a/xen/include/asm-x86/hvm/io.h b/xen/include/asm-x86/hvm/io.h
index 4594e91..2b22b50 100644
--- a/xen/include/asm-x86/hvm/io.h
+++ b/xen/include/asm-x86/hvm/io.h
@@ -43,6 +43,22 @@ struct hvm_mmio_ops {
hvm_mmio_write_t write;
};
+static inline paddr_t hvm_mmio_first_byte(const ioreq_t *p)
+{
+ return p->df ?
+ p->addr - (p->count - 1ul) * p->size :
+ p->addr;
+}
+
+static inline paddr_t hvm_mmio_last_byte(const ioreq_t *p)
+{
+ unsigned long count = p->count;
+
+ return p->df ?
+ p->addr + p->size - 1:
+ p->addr + (count * p->size) - 1;
+}
+
